.
Dalam JavaScript, titik bertindih (:) berfungsi sebagai pengendali dan mempunyai pelbagai kegunaan.
1. Pengendali tugasanPenggunaan kolon yang paling biasa adalah sebagai pengendali tugasan. Ia memberikan nilai ungkapan kepada pembolehubah. Contohnya:
let x = 10; x += 5; // 等效于 x = x + 5
Kolon juga digunakan sebagai operator bersyarat, juga dikenali sebagai operator ternary. Ia mengembalikan satu daripada dua nilai berdasarkan ungkapan bersyarat. Sintaksnya adalah seperti berikut:
条件 ? 值1 : 值2
Contohnya:
const isEven = n => (n % 2 === 0) ? true : false;
Kolon boleh digunakan untuk menambah label pada pernyataan. Ini membolehkan penggunaan pernyataan
untuk melompat ke pernyataan yang ditanda. Contohnya:myLabel: while (condition) { // ... }
break
或 continue
4 literal objekDalam literal objek, titik bertindih digunakan untuk menentukan kunci dan nilai. Contohnya:
const person = { name: "John Doe", age: 30 };
Dalam ES6, titik bertindih boleh digunakan dengan operator spread (...) untuk mengembangkan tatasusunan atau objek. Contohnya:
const arr1 = [1, 2, 3]; const arr2 = [...arr1, 4, 5]; // [1, 2, 3, 4, 5]
Dalam TypeScript, titik bertindih digunakan untuk menentukan jenis pembolehubah atau fungsi. Contohnya:
let num: number = 10;
Atas ialah kandungan terperinci Apakah maksud kolon dalam js.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!